The acquisition of Tony Mandina's Restaurant in 1980 started as a real estate venture. While working as a furniture executive Tony Mandina worked on the restaurant on weekends and after hours. His plan was to lease the building as a restaurant after repairs were finished. However, upon completion, Tony, Grace and their three daughters decided to open the restaurant themselves. On November 15th, 1982, the doors were opened. The place was small and modest. In the beginning, Grace managed the business while Tony remained in the furniture business. After a few years, Tony joined the restaurant full time and with his full concentration, the business began to expand. Before long there was another expansion and then another to its present status.
